The skeletal remains of a Confederate soldier, hidden deep within the Paris Catacombs. The legend of a long-lost Confederate treasure. An aged scrap of paper that reads simple. Berceau de solitude (cradle of solitude). It was sheer dumb luck really. Archaeologist, Annja Creed happened to be in Paris when the bones of the soldier were discovered.

Rogue Angel is a 43-book series with 42 released primary works first released in 2006 with contributions by Victor Milán, Mel Odom, and Alex Archer.
